About Smarr, Georgia

Smarr rests in a landscape of gentle, rolling hills, a place where the Georgia red clay sings a quiet song beneath a sky that often bleeds into hues of peach and lavender at dusk. It lies 17.6 miles north-west of Macon, GA (from Macon, GA: bearing 305°T), and is situated 4.7 miles south-east of Forsyth. The terrain here is a subtle mosaic of pine stands, their needles whispering secrets to the breeze, and fields that stretch out like worn, welcome mats, hinting at the cultivation that has shaped this land for generations. The air, particularly in the early morning, carries a damp, earthy scent, mingled with the distant perfume of honeysuckle, a sweetness that clings to the quiet mornings before the sun fully asserts its dominion. The history of Smarr is etched not in grand monuments, but in the slow, steady rhythm of its agricultural past, a legacy still visible in the weathered barns and the broad sweep of its farmland. This area, once a vital artery for timber and cotton, now finds its economic heartbeat in the enduring strength of its soil and the quiet industry that supports it. Local traditions, passed down through families, are the true landmarks here, found in the shared stories at the general store and the enduring sense of neighborliness that binds the people of Smarr together, a quiet resilience woven into the very fabric of its days.
